Excel 怎么算数?——完整使用指南#
问题:在 Excel 中如何进行各种数值计算?
目标:帮助你从基础到进阶,快速掌握 Excel 的算数技巧。
1. 原因分析#
| 可能导致“Excel 怎么算数”困惑的原因 | 说明 |
|---|---|
| 公式语法不熟悉 | Excel 计算都是通过公式完成,初学者常常不知道公式的基本写法。 |
| 单元格引用错误 | 公式中引用单元格时,使用错误的相对/绝对引用会导致结果不对。 |
| 数据格式和类型 | 文本被误认为数值或数值被误认为文本会导致计算错误。 |
| 函数使用不当 | 选择错误的函数、缺少必要参数,或没有考虑函数的返回值类型。 |
| 计算顺序与优先级 | 括号使用不当会导致运算顺序错误。 |
2. 三种分步骤的解决方案#
下面给出 三条典型方案,分别适用于不同需求:
1️⃣ 基础算术(+、-、*、/、^、% 等)
2️⃣ 高级函数(SUM、AVERAGE、COUNT、IF 等)
3️⃣ 自定义公式(数组公式、动态数组、命名范围)
2.1 方案一:基础算术运算#
| 步骤 | 操作 | 示例 |
|---|---|---|
| 1️⃣ | 打开工作簿并定位到目标单元格 | Sheet1!C1 |
| 2️⃣ | 输入等号 = 开始公式 |
=5+3 |
| 3️⃣ | 使用标准运算符 | =A1+B1-C1*D1/E1 |
| 4️⃣ | 使用括号控制优先级 | =(A1+B1)*(C1-D1)/E1 |
| 5️⃣ | 复制公式 | 选中单元格右下角拖动或 Ctrl+C/Ctrl+V |
小技巧:按
Ctrl + ~可以查看所有单元格的公式,便于调试。
2.2 方案二:使用常用函数#
| 函数 | 作用 | 示例 | 备注 |
|---|---|---|---|
SUM() |
求和 | =SUM(A1:A10) |
也可用 + 链接 |
AVERAGE() |
平均数 | =AVERAGE(B1:B10) |
自动忽略空单元格 |
COUNT() |
计数 | =COUNT(C1:C10) |
只计数数值 |
COUNTA() |
非空计数 | =COUNTA(D1:D10) |
计数文本与数值 |
MAX() / MIN() |
最大/最小值 | =MAX(E1:E10) |
|
IF() |
条件判断 | =IF(F1>10,"大","小") |
可嵌套 |
VLOOKUP() |
垂直查找 | =VLOOKUP(G1,Sheet2!A:B,2,FALSE) |
步骤示例:
1️⃣ 选中目标单元格。
2️⃣ 输入 =SUM( 并选中需要求和的范围。
3️⃣ 关闭括号,按 Enter。
小技巧:按
Ctrl+Shift+Enter可以创建 数组公式(需在旧版 Excel 中使用)。
2.3 方案三:动态数组与命名范围#
2.3.1 动态数组公式(Excel 365/Excel 2019+)#
| 公式 | 作用 | 示例 |
|---|---|---|
SORT() |
排序 | =SORT(A1:A10) |
FILTER() |
按条件筛选 | =FILTER(B1:B10, C1:C10>5) |
UNIQUE() |
去重 | =UNIQUE(D1:D10) |
示例:
=FILTER(A1:C10, B1:B10="是")只返回 B 列等于 “是” 的行。
2.3.2 命名范围#
1️⃣ 选中需要命名的单元格或区域。
2️⃣ 在“名称框”(左上角下拉框)输入名称,例如 SalesData。
3️⃣ 在公式中使用:=SUM(SalesData)。
优势:公式更易读,避免引用错误。
3. 常见问题解答(FAQ)#
| 问题 | 解决方案 |
|---|---|
Q1:公式返回错误值 #VALUE! |
检查是否有文本与数值混用,或使用 TEXT 函数转为数值。 |
| Q2:怎么把文本的数字转换成数值? | 选中单元格,点击“数据”→“文本到列”,或使用 VALUE()。 |
| Q3:公式不更新 | 按 Ctrl+Alt+F9 强制刷新,或检查工作簿设置是否为“手动计算”。 |
| Q4:怎么在单元格里显示两个数的和 | 直接输入 =A1+B1 或 =SUM(A1,B1)。 |
Q5:为什么 A1/B1 显示 #DIV/0! |
B1 可能为 0 或空白;可使用 IFERROR(A1/B1,"") 处理。 |
| Q6:如何在单元格中添加百分比 | 选中单元格,右键→“设置单元格格式”→“百分比”。 |
| Q7:公式里使用了相对引用,复制后出现错误 | 需要使用绝对引用 $A$1 或 A$1、$A1。 |
| Q8:如何做条件求和(SUMIF/SUMIFS) | =SUMIF(range, criteria, [sum_range]) 或 =SUMIFS(sum_range, criteria_range1, criteria1, …) |
Q9:公式里出现 #NAME? |
检查函数拼写、是否使用了不存在的命名范围。 |
| Q10:如何把两列合并成一列 | =A1 & " " & B1 或 =CONCAT(A1,B1)。 |
4. 小结#
- 掌握公式语法:先从
=开始,用运算符或函数完成计算。 - 熟悉常用函数:SUM、AVERAGE、IF 等是日常计算的核心。
- 使用命名范围与动态数组:提升公式可读性与灵活性。
- 排查错误:先检查数据类型、引用、函数参数,再看错误提示。
祝你在 Excel 的数值计算之旅玩得愉快 🚀!